A –2– ADMC(F)341–SPECIFICATIONS ANALOG-TO-DIGITAL CONVERTER Parameter Min Typ Max Unit Conditions/Comments Signal Input 0.3 3.5 V VAUX0, VAUX1, VAUX2 Resolution 1 12 Bits Linearity Error 2 3 4 Bits Zero Offset 3 –32 0 +7 mV Comparator Delay 600 ns ADC High Level Input Current 2 +10 µAV IN = 3.5 V ADC Low Level Input Current 2 –10 µAVIN = 0.0 V NOTES 1Resolution varies with PWM switching frequency (double update mode) 78.1 kHz = 8 bits, 4.9 kHz = 12 bits. 22.44 kHz sample frequency, VAUX0, VAUX1, VAUX2. 3Extrapolated point outside of operating range. 2.44 kHz sample frequency. Specifications subject to change without notice. ISENSE AMPLIFIER–TRIP Parameter Min Typ Max Unit Conditions/Comments ISENSE Signal Operating Range –400 +400 mV ISENSE Signal Input Range –800 +800 mV ISENSE Gain –2.6 –2.51 –2.34 % VIN = –400 mV to +400 mV ISENSE Gain Channel Matching 5.5 % VIN = –400 mV to +400 mV ISENSE Gain Stability 1 0.8 % VIN = –400 mV to +400 mV ISENSE Linearity 2 89 Bits ISENSE Internal Offset Voltage 2 1.68 1.87 2.1 V ISENSE Internal Offset Stability 2 2.1 % ISENSE Signal-to-Noise Ratio (SNRD) 3 51 dB ISENSE Signal-to-Noise Ratio Less Distortion 54 dB (SNR)3 ISENSE Total Harmonic Distortion 3 –53 dB ISENSE Input Current –200 +10 µAVIN = –400 mV to +400 mV ISENSE Input Resistance 11.5 k Ω TRIP Threshold Low –690 –430 mV TRIP Threshold High +430 +690 mV TRIP Minimum Pulsewidth4 5 µs NOTES 1Variation of gain with V DD and temperature. 2V IN = –400 mV to +400 mV. 3f IN = 1 kHz sine wave, VIN = –400 mV to +400 mV, fS = 4 kHz. 4High or low trip threshold. Specifications subject to change without notice. CURRENT SOURCE1 Parameter Min Typ Max Unit Conditions/Comments Programming Resolution 3 Bits Tuned Current 2 91 100 109 µA NOTES 1For ADC calibration. 20.3 V to 3.5 V I CONST voltage. Specifications subject to change without notice. (VDD = 5%, GND = 0 V. For ADMCF341, TA = –40 C to +85 C. For ADMC341, TA = –40 C to +125 C. CLKIN = 10 MHz, unless otherwise noted.) |
